How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South of Katella?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
South of Katella Studio Apartments | $2,351 | $1,550 | $3,139 |
South of Katella 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,637 | $1,595 | $5,663 |
South of Katella 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,284 | $1,785 | $7,941 |
South of Katella 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,428 | $3,095 | $4,200 |
